Subject: Order-cutoff rule handover

Hi all — quick heads-up for the new folks at Millbarrow Bakehouse. The 2 p.m. order-cutoff rule for next-day custom cakes is changing hands this week. Exceptions, rush orders, and cutoff disputes all go through one person now, so please stop pinging the whole channel. Route everything to the contact below.

account owner for bawip-tahag: Raleth Quenok

// Client setup for the Stallwatch occupancy feed.
// This polls the Garagepoint internal API every 30s for per-level
// occupancy counts across the Northquay structures and pushes
// deltas to the signage service. Discussed at last week's sync:
// we now batch updates to cut request volume by ~60%.
// Retries use exponential backoff capped at 5 minutes.
// The client authenticates with the key configured below.

API key for yahig-tadup: kto7_ubizbYm

## Configuration

The Willowgate clinic reminder job runs nightly and sends appointment reminders for the following two days. Copy env.sample to .env on the scheduler host, set REMINDER_WINDOW_DAYS and CLINIC_TIMEZONE, then verify the dry-run output. The messaging gateway requires an auth credential, which you should place on the line immediately below.

vault entry, yahif-yajep: COURIER_KEY29=b802bdf8034096b65a51c6ba5abe2

## Further reading

The Bellminder timetable solver uses constraint propagation with simulated annealing fallback; understanding both helps when diagnosing stuck solve jobs. Solver timeouts, room-conflict scoring, and the term-rollover procedure are each covered in separate docs. For the on-call triage flowchart and solver tuning notes, start with the internal page below.

runbook for badug-kadup: https://confluence.zemvarlabs.internal/projects/browse/display/projects/bd1b

CI note: reminder-job flakes on Briarhold clinic pipeline

Heads up — the appointment reminder job keeps failing in CI, but only on the nightly run. Turns out the test fixture seeds appointments relative to "tomorrow," and the nightly runs at 23:58 local, so half the reminders land outside the send window. Daytime runs never hit it. Fix is to freeze the clock in the fixture setup, which the patch on the queue does. If it flakes again, compare against the build stamped below.

pipeline stamp: htk31_f769b577b3028a4e9958e5bb8d1259a